Nottingham Forest set Morgan Gibbs-White price tag as Manchester City and Liverpool eye summer move
TBR Football can exclusively reveal that Nottingham Forest are ready to demand a massive fee for Morgan Gibbs-White amid interest from Manchester City and Liverpool
Nuno Espirito Santo’s side are having an amazing season in the Premier League. They are currently third in the table and are now likely to qualify for next season’s Champions League.
A number of Forest players have performed brilliantly this season, but none more than Gibbs-White, who has been excellent.
That has alerted several big clubs, but Forest are not going to make it easy for any of them in this summer’s transfer window.
Nottingham Forest’s price tag for Manchester City and Liverpool target Morgan Gibbs-White
TBR Football’s chief correspondent Graeme Bailey understands that Nottingham Forest are ready to demand up to £100 million for their England midfielder Gibbs-White this summer.
The Reds have enjoyed a superb season to date as they look to seal a Champions League slot whilst also booking a place in the FA Cup last four.
Gibbs-White has been one of the stand-out performers for Santo’s side, and Forest’s belief is that he has been the best central attacking midfielder in the Premier League this season.
The 25-year-old was left out of Thomas Tuchel’s initial selection for his first England squad but was later called up when Chelsea’s Cole Palmer pulled out.
Some have suggested that Gibbs-White could need to leave the City Ground to push his claims as one of England’s top performers.
Forest sources dismiss these claims and insist that they are not looking to lose Gibbs-White, or any of their star performers.
However, the midfielder’s performances have, unsurprisingly, attracted interest from elsewhere.
Champions Manchester City are keeping tabs on his situation, as are their likely successors, Liverpool. Sources confirm to TBR that Eddie Howe is a huge fan of the player too and would like Newcastle United to challenge for his signature if he was available.
There is also interest abroad. We are told that RB Leipzig are huge admirers and they see Gibbs-White as a possible replacement for Xavi Simons, who could move this summer.
But, Forest are not willing sellers, and we are told that they see Gibbs-White in the £100 million bracket.
The Reds base that on the fact that they think he is comparable to Jack Grealish when he moved to Manchester City in 2021.

What Nottingham Forest are now planning to do to keep Gibbs-White
TBR exclusively revealed in March that Nottingham Forest are planning to offer Gibbs-White a new contract to extend his stay at the club.
The 25-year-old has been at the City Ground since joining them from Wolves in 2022, and he will enter the final two years of his contract this summer.
Furthermore, Santo’s side are ready to make some major investment in the upcoming window – TBR can reveal that Wolves star Matheus Cunha is amongst Forest’s top targets.
The Reds hope that their ambition will show Gibbs-White that his immediate future is best served at the City Ground.
